Types of ADUs Peragallo Construction Builds

Peragallo Construction offers several ADU configurations to suit different property types and homeowner needs:

  1. Detached Backyard ADUs: Standalone accessory dwelling units built on the existing lot, separate from the main home. These are suitable for rental use, guest accommodations, or independent living arrangements.
  2. Attached In-Law Suites: ADUs connected directly to the primary residence, designed for aging parents, live-in relatives, or multi-generational households. These units are built to integrate with the existing home's layout while offering a degree of privacy.
  3. Garage Conversion ADUs: Converting an existing garage into a livable accessory dwelling unit. This typically involves insulation, utility connections, layout planning, and finish work. Garage conversions are often a cost-effective option since the base structure already exists.
  4. Basement ADU Apartments: Transforming unfinished or underused basement space into a code-compliant apartment. These conversions are well-suited for rental income or accommodating extended family members.
  5. Over-Garage or Upper-Level ADUs: Building an ADU above an existing garage or upper level of the home. This approach makes use of vertical space, which can be particularly practical on smaller Connecticut lots.

For homeowners considering an ADU in Connecticut, it's worth noting that construction costs in the state tend to be higher than national averages. Factors such as stricter building codes, permit requirements, utility upgrades, labor costs, and site-specific conditions all contribute to pricing. Most ADUs in Connecticut range from $150,000 to $350,000, depending on size, structure type, layout, and finish selections. Detached units and higher-end finishes typically fall toward the upper end of that range.

Garage conversions are generally the more affordable ADU option, as the existing structure reduces foundational costs — though upgrades for insulation, ceiling height, or utility compliance can still add to the overall budget. Costs can often be managed by keeping layouts simple, limiting square footage, and selecting mid-range finishes.
